struktur WIFI_POWER_OFFLOAD_LIST (wificxpoweroffloadlist.h)

Struktur WIFI_POWER_OFFLOAD_LIST mewakili daftar offload protokol daya rendah ke adaptor bersih WiFiCx.

Sintaks

typedef struct _WIFI_POWER_OFFLOAD_LIST {
  ULONG Size;
  void  *Reserved[4];
} WIFI_POWER_OFFLOAD_LIST;

Anggota

Size

Ukuran struktur ini, dalam byte.

Reserved[4]

Dicadangkan. Driver klien tidak boleh membaca atau menulis ke nilai ini secara langsung.

Keterangan

Panggil WIFI_POWER_OFFLOAD_LIST_INIT untuk menginisialisasi struktur ini, lalu panggil WifiDeviceGetPowerOffloadList untuk mendapatkan daftar offload daya rendah ke adaptor bersih WiFiCx ini. Setelah Anda mendapatkan daftar, panggil WifiPowerOffloadListGetCount dengan struktur ini untuk mendapatkan jumlah objek WIFIPOWEROFFLOAD yang mewakili offload, lalu ulangi objek dan panggil WifiPowerOffloadListGetElement untuk mengambil masing-masing objek. Setelah Anda mendapatkan objek WIFIPOWEROFFLOAD, panggil WifiPowerOffloadGetType untuk mendapatkan jenis offload tersebut sehingga Anda dapat memanggil fungsi yang sesuai untuk mendapatkan parameter offload.

Driver klien hanya boleh memanggil fungsi terkait offload daya selama transisi daya, biasanya dari fungsi panggilan balik EVT_WDF_DEVICE_ARM_WAKE_FROM_SX, EVT_WDF_DEVICE_ARM_WAKE_FROM_S0, atau EVT_NET_DEVICE_PREVIEW_POWER_OFFLOAD . Jika tidak, panggilan akan menghasilkan pemeriksaan bug sistem.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ows 11
Server minimum yang didukung Windows Server 2022
Header wificxpoweroffloadlist.h

Lihat juga

WIFI_POWER_OFFLOAD_LIST_INIT

WifiDeviceGetPowerOffloadList

WifiPowerOffloadListGetCount

WifiPowerOffloadListGetElement

WifiPowerOffloadGetType